Fastly, Inc. Class A Common Stock

TECHNOLOGY · SOFTWARE - APPLICATION · USA

Fastly, Inc. operates an edge cloud platform to process, serve, and protect its customers' applications in the United States, Asia Pacific, Europe, and internationally. The company is headquartered in San Francisco, California.

Uber Technologies Inc

TECHNOLOGY · SOFTWARE - APPLICATION · USA

Uber Technologies, Inc., commonly known as Uber, is an American technology company. Its services include ride-hailing, food delivery (Uber Eats), package delivery, couriers, freight transportation, and, through a partnership with Lime, electric bicycle and motorized scooter rental. The company is based in San Francisco, California.
